Show more "Sandhurst Grange has 34 one and two bed apartments with a range of facilities including a library, guest room and shared lounge. The regular coffee mornings give an opportunity to socialise with other residents, should you wish to do so. The estate manager is on-site every week day to assist with any queries you may have and also arrange any maintenance required for the buildings and grounds.The site is well located near the local shops. The bus stop at the end of the street has a variety of services including Fleetwood and Cleveleys market. The estate is also very close to St Annes-on-Sea railway station for trips into Blackpool or Preston." Show less
Main Facts
Retirement housing
Tenure(s): Leasehold
33 flats. Built in 1989. Sizes 1 bedroom, 2 bedroom.
Non-resident management staff (part time) and Careline alarm service
Lift, Lounge, Laundry, Guest facilities, Garden, Library
Access to site easy, but less so for less mobile people. Distances: bus stop 100 yards; shop 400 yards; post office 500 yards; town centre 400 yards; GP 150 yards.
Regular Social activities include: coffee mornings. New residents accepted from 55 years of age. Both cats & dogs generally accepted (subject to prior approval and conditions).
Housing Authority: Fylde
Social Care Authority: Lancashire
